In a light-hearted and creative twist, the latest ad from Google’s #BestPhonesForever series, titled “Happy Diwali,” explores the friendship between two of the world’s most popular smartphones: the iPhone and the Pixel. As the Hindu Festival of Lights, Diwali, approaches, the ad features the iPhone cheerfully greeting its Pixel counterpart, specifically the Pixel 9 Pro, with a “Happy Diwali” message. This festive greeting sets the stage for a series of playful interactions between the two devices.
The ad cleverly uses stop-action animation to depict iPhone making a series of well-intentioned Diwali wishes for the Pixel. These wishes include hopes that Pixel will soon gain new artificial intelligence (AI) abilities such as having live conversations with Gemini, summarizing unread emails, and adding a person to group photos even if they were the photographer. However, in a humorous twist, each of these hoped-for capabilities are already part of the Pixel 9 Pro’s feature set.
The ad highlights Google’s advanced AI innovations by demonstrating that the Pixel 9 Pro can indeed perform all these tasks. One notable feature, whimsically referenced as “Add Me,” allows the Pixel to include the photographer in a group photo by leaving space in the original image. The comedic moment reaches a peak as the iPhone, out of wishes, asks Pixel what its own Diwali wish might be. The Pixel warmly responds with, “I already got it. The World’s Best Friend,” pointing towards the amicable bond portrayed between the two devices. Following this interplay, Google extends Diwali greetings to everyone celebrating the festival.
BestPhonesForever has garnered a substantial following online, appealing to both iPhone and Pixel enthusiasts. The series presents a friendly rivalry, often showcasing the Pixel’s latest features while maintaining a humorous rapport with its Apple counterpart. These animations have become popular for their engaging storytelling and unique presentation style that draws viewers in with a narrative beyond technical specs.
